The L1 visa is a non-immigrant category that enables business to move staff members from consular services to their U.S. branches, subsidiaries, or associates. This visa category is especially helpful for multinational firms looking for to leverage their international ability pool by transferring essential employees to boost procedures in the USA. The L1 visa is divided into two main subcategories: L1A for supervisors and execs, and L1B for staff members with specialized understanding, each accommodating different business needs.The L1 visa promotes the smooth activity of certified staff members, thus fostering global organization growth and functional performance. With the L1A visa, firms can transfer individuals that hold supervisory or executive functions, enabling them to make tactical decisions and look after certain departments within the united state entity. Alternatively, the L1B visa is developed for workers having specialized understanding crucial to the firm's passions, ensuring that the U.S. workplace take advantage of distinct abilities and expertise.One noteworthy advantage of the L1 visa is its double intent nature, which permits holders to request long-term residency while keeping their non-immigrant condition. In addition, partners and kids of L1 visa owners can accompany them to the USA under the L2 visa classification, which likewise permits job permission
Kinds of L1 Visas
Multiple types of L1 visas deal with the varied needs of multinational companies aiming to transfer staff members to the United States. Both key groups of L1 visas are L1A and L1B, each developed for specific roles and obligations within an organization.The L1A visa is planned for supervisors and executives. This group allows companies to move individuals that hold managerial or executive settings, enabling them to supervise procedures in the united state. This visa is legitimate for an initial period of up to three years, with the opportunity of extensions for a total amount of approximately 7 years. The L1A visa is specifically helpful for business looking for to establish a strong leadership visibility in the united state market.On the various other hand, the L1B visa is designated for staff members with specialized understanding. This includes individuals that have sophisticated know-how in certain areas, such as exclusive innovations or distinct processes within the company. The L1B visa is additionally valid for a first three-year duration, with extensions available for up to five years. This visa classification is perfect for business that call for staff members with specialized skills to improve their operations and keep an one-upmanship in the U. To receive an L1 visa, both the company and the employee need to meet particular eligibility criteria set by U.S. immigration authorities. The L1 visa is designed for intra-company transferees, allowing international business to transfer employees to their U.S. offices.First, the employer has to be a certifying organization, which implies it needs to have a parent business, branch, subsidiary, or associate that is operating both in the united state and in the foreign nation. This relationship is crucial for demonstrating that the employee is being moved within the exact same company framework. The company must likewise have actually been doing company for at the very least one year in both locations.Second, the worker should have been utilized by the international firm for at the very least one constant year within the 3 years coming before the application. This work needs to be in a supervisory, executive, or specialized expertise capacity. For L1A visas, which accommodate supervisors and executives, the worker should show that they will certainly remain to run in a similar ability in the U.S. For L1B visas, meant for staff members with specialized expertise, the specific have to have unique knowledge that contributes considerably to the business's procedures.Application Process
Navigating the application procedure for an L1 visa includes a number of crucial actions that must be completed precisely to guarantee an effective end result. The primary step is to identify the appropriate group of the L1 visa: L1A for supervisors and execs, or L1B for employees with specialized knowledge (L1 Visa Requirements). This difference is substantial, as it impacts the documents required.Once the group is identified, the U.S. company need to submit Type I-129, Petition for a Nonimmigrant Worker. This form ought to consist of in-depth details about the company, the staff member's role, and the nature of the job to be done in the U.S. Accompanying documents commonly consists of proof of the connection in between the united state and international entities, evidence of the employee's certifications, and info pertaining to the task offer.After submission, the united state Citizenship and Migration Services (USCIS) will certainly evaluate the request. If authorized, the worker will certainly be alerted, and they can then look for the visa at an U.S. consular office or embassy in their home nation. This includes finishing Kind DS-160, the Online Nonimmigrant copyright, and scheduling an interview.During the interview, the applicant needs to offer numerous files, consisting of the accepted Kind I-129, proof of employment, and any type of added sustaining evidence. Adhering to the interview, if the visa is granted, the employee will certainly get a visa stamp in their key, allowing them to go into the U.S. to benefit the funding employer. While the L1 visa supplies numerous benefits for multinational companies and their workers, it is not without its obstacles. One noteworthy hurdle is the rigorous documentation and qualification requirements imposed by the united state Citizenship and Migration Services (USCIS) Business need to provide thorough proof of the international worker's certifications, the nature of the company, and the qualifying partnership between the U.S. and international entities. This process can be time-consuming and may need legal experience to browse successfully.Another challenge is the possibility for examination throughout the request process. USCIS policemans might examine the authenticity of the organization procedures or the staff member's function within the company. This analysis can result in hold-ups or even rejections of the copyright, which can considerably impact the company's operational strategies and the worker's career trajectory.Furthermore, the L1 visa is connected to the funding employer, which means that work changes can complicate the visa status. If an L1 visa owner wishes to switch over companies, they need to frequently pursue a different visa category, which can add intricacy to their immigration journey.Lastly, preserving conformity with L1 visa guidelines is essential. Employers need to assure that their employee's function lines up with the initial petition which the organization remains to fulfill the eligibility demands. Failing to do so can lead to retraction of the visa, affecting both the staff member and the company. Can Family Members Members Accompany L1 Visa Holders?
Yes, family members can go along with L1 visa owners. Partners and unmarried kids under 21 years of ages are qualified for L2 visas, which allow them to live and research in the USA during the L1 owner's stay.How Much Time Can L1 Visa Holders Remain in the united state?
L1 visa holders can at first remain in the united state for up to three years. This period might be expanded, permitting an optimum stay of 7 years for L1A visa holders and 5 years for L1B visa ownersIs the L1 Visa a Twin Intent Visa?
The L1 visa is thought about a dual intent visa, enabling owners to pursue long-term residency while maintaining their temporary non-immigrant standing. This flexibility assists in long-term occupation chances for worldwide workers within U.S. companies.
